Miami City Ballet Dancers are Back

September 2009.

Miami City Ballet dancers are back from summer break and in the studios rehearsing for an exciting line-up of performances which begin in October. Among the many dances being rehearsed is Paul Taylor’s signature work Company B, being staged by former Paul Taylor Dance Company member Patrick Corbin.

Company B is a carefree dance set to World War II hits by the Andrews Sisters (“Rum and Coca Cola,” “Boogie Woggie Bugle Boy,” “Oh, Johnny, Oh!”) contrasted with the melancholy realities of soldiers at war. Patrick Corbin danced for Paul Taylor from 1989-2005 and was one of his most celebrated members. Corbin worked with Miami City Ballet last season staging Mercuric Tidings and the company is thrilled to have him back again to set Company B.

Corbin has been featured in five PBS Great Performances between 1988 and 2004 and the 1998 Academy Award nominated documentary Dancemaker. In 2001, he was the recipient of the New York Performance Award (Bessie) for Sustained Achievement with the Paul Taylor Dance Company. He founded CorbinDances his own company in 2005.

Miami City Ballet also announced that the following dancers have been promoted: Alex Wong to Principal Soloist; Daniel Baker and Carlos Quenedit to Soloist; and Cindy Huang, Helen Ruiz, Elizabeth Smedley, and Nicole Stalker to Corps de Ballet. Two guest artists Katia Carranza and Yann Trividic will rejoin the company for some productions. Carranza and Tividic both performed full-time as principal dancers for Miami City Ballet for several years.

Joining the company this season as Miami City Ballet School Apprentices are: Nathalia Arja, Renan Cerdeiro, Alexandre Ferreira, and Yoalli Sousa Sanchez.
